我是从事大数据分析的,有想把一些数据可视化的想法,刚开始接触,我尽量把我的意思表达清楚:
柱状图,饼状图这种实现很简单也是传统的数据可视化了。但是对于大数据,比如在全球(或中国)地图上显示用户分布,一个用户一个点,再加上他们之间的连线表示好友关系等。这种用某种技术(比如js)也可以实现,但是需要编程和算法,还有做成3D的呢(像宇宙一样,一个星球比喻一个用户)?一个可以拉进,一个鼠标放到一个点上就能显示这个点的详细信息等。目前还没有看到有做成3D的。
我也看过twetter(js做的)和facebook(R做的)的图,还有俄罗斯专家画的全球网站的分布图。但是这些都是像一个项目一样需要花大量时间才能实现的,学习成本太高。
有没有工具能够简单的帮我们做到? 我用过gephi,但是2W个点就跑不动了,太局限于单机性能了。
或者大家有没有什么好的建议?
我们简单的用html5画的静态图如下,每个点代表一个用户,但是背景是静态的,不能局部放大某个省或者其他的事件触发。感觉效果很不好:
duzelong1988